The presentation entitled IGIV: Issues and Concerns that may affect patient treatment, was repeated twice during the congress and challenged the perceived wisdom that all IGIV´s are equal. She explained that differences in the starting material, manufacturing method, virus inactivation, purification, stabilisation and final formulation of commercial IGIV preparations may affect the safety, efficacy, tolerability and/or convenience of the finished product and have a significant impact on clinical outcome
